Traditional Styles for Girls
Girls have many options for festive occasions. Lehenga choli sets remain popular because they create a colorful and graceful appearance. Anarkali dresses offer a flowing silhouette, while sharara sets provide a modern festive touch. With an Indian Outfit for Kids, parents can choose embroidery, prints, sequins, or borders according to the event.
Light embellishments suit younger children because they add charm without making clothing heavy. Peach, pink, lavender, cream, and mint suit daytime celebrations. For evenings, maroon, emerald, navy, and royal blue create a richer look.
Stylish Choices for Boys
Boys can dress traditionally while enjoying practical designs. Kurta pajama sets are versatile for festivals and family celebrations, while sherwanis provide a formal appearance for weddings. Nehru jackets can add structure and color to a simple outfit. An Indian Outfit for Kids becomes appealing when these elements are combined with breathable fabrics and comfortable fits.
Parents should consider activity levels before choosing heavily decorated clothing. Children may spend hours walking, eating, dancing, and playing. Therefore, flexible fabrics and secure fastenings make clothing easier to manage.
Choosing Comfortable Fabrics
Fabric selection matters in children’s clothing. Cotton, cotton blends, lightweight silk, rayon, and breathable festive fabrics can provide comfort when selected appropriately. Lightweight materials suit warm months, while layered styles provide warmth during cooler celebrations.
A well-planned Indian Outfit for Kids should have smooth seams, comfortable waistbands, and suitable necklines. Secure construction is important for younger children.

Dressing for Different Occasions
Every event has different clothing requirements. Weddings usually call for richer fabrics and elegant details, while festivals may suit colorful and lightweight outfits. Birthday celebrations allow playful prints and contemporary ethnic designs. School cultural programs often require traditional clothing that is easy to manage.
An Indian Outfit for Kids can be versatile enough for several occasions when parents choose classic colors and practical silhouettes. Such pieces can become useful wardrobe additions, especially for growing children.
Smart Shopping Tips
Parents should shop early before weddings and major festivals. This allows time for size checks, alterations, and accessory matching. Children grow quickly, so checking measurements is more reliable than selecting a size based only on age.
When comparing an Indian Outfit for Kids, parents should examine stitching, fabric quality, lining, embellishment, and washing instructions. It is also useful to consider whether the child can put on or remove the outfit easily. Practical details matter during long celebrations.
